The Real Club Náutico de Arrecife sailing team was present this past weekend in the Spanish Association of Yacht Clubs Trophy, a competition that took place in the waters of Gijón and was organized by the Real Club Astur de Regatas. The five sailors from Lanzarote who traveled to Asturian lands performed a great navigation, occupying the first three positions of the podium and revalidating the Real Club Náutico de Arrecife's title of champion in the Spanish Association of Yacht Clubs Trophy.
The Spanish Association of Yacht Clubs Trophy took place in the optimist class, and the Real Club Náutico de Arrecife expedition that traveled to Gijón was made up of Yeico José Díaz Molina, Leandro de la Hoz González, Pelayo Sánchez Reguero, María Rizo García and Rosalía Lasso Morales. The five sailors were accompanied during the competition by coach Carlos Hidalgo.
The first two races of Saturday's day were marked by the light wind blowing in Gijón bay, increasing its intensity up to 15 knots in the last heat of Saturday. On Sunday, the sailors had to stay ashore due to weather conditions and the three planned races could not be held.
Pelayo Sánchez, with two second places and a fifth position on Saturday, took the individual victory in the Spanish Association of Yacht Clubs Trophy. The second place on the podium was occupied by Leandro de la Hoz, and in third position was María Rizo, with Real Club Náutico de Arrecife sailors dominating the podium of the general classification. In addition, María Rizo took the victory in the female category.
These results allow the Real Club Náutico de Arrecife to revalidate the title of champion of the Spanish Association of Yacht Clubs Trophy, demonstrating their sailors' good performance in any race course.
